Bilirakis Speaks With Local Purple Heart Veterans On National Purple Heart Day

Zephyrhills, FL:  Earlier today, U.S. Congressman Gus Bilirakis spoke to the Greater Tampa Chapter of the Military Order of the Purple Heart (MOPH).  Every member of this organization has been awarded the Purple Heart for combat-related injuries.  On this national Purple Heart Day, Bilirakis recognized the service and sacrifice of these heroes and provided an update on the work he is doing locally to benefit our heroes, including: securing funding for a new bed tower at James A. Haley Veterans Hospital and for new outpatient clinics in New Port Richey, Zephyrhills, and Countryside. Bilirakis also highlighted recent legislative victories, such as final passage of the PACT Act, which includes several Bilirakis-authored provisions.  In addition to these updates, Bilirakis spoke with the purple heart recipients about the state of our nation and the steps he believes must be taken to strengthen national security and improve military readiness.
